Warranty Expiring Last Min Fixes???

Hello all, my factory warranty on my GLK 350 is expiring in a few months. I want to get everything I can out of the warranty before that happens. You all know how expensive these things can get once out of warranty (I will have a separate extended warranty kick in for a couple more years but it does not cover as much).

Any suggestions for services or things I can have checked and fixed (if needed) before the warranty runs out?

Warranty is really for broken stuff so if it works, it works.
Go to a dealer and ask them to go over the car (maybe pay for an hour of their time)...they will be happy to do the work and bill to MB.
Check transfer case for leaks.
It would be great if you can get new engine mounts under warranty but they are probably fine (no excessive vibrations).
The soft air runners to the air filter get very brittle and break, they are 60 bucks each.
Inspect the brakes for warped rotors and any stuck pistons in the calipers.

I would not bother with extended warranties for GLK, unless prices came down. When I looked, you could cover quite a few big repairs before breaking even on the warranty.
It's a simple car and not that many things go wrong. If things break, they seem to happened in the first 40-50k miles.
